Alex Hammerstone to undergo minor procedure for knee injury

TNA star Hammerstone will be undergoing surgery for a knee injury which kept him out of the Final Resolution event this past Friday.

Hammerstone was scheduled to team up with Jake Something against PCO and Sami Callihan and The Rascalz in a triple tag team match but the company announced that he was not medically cleared to compete.

In a post on social media, the 33-year-old said that for the first time in his career, he has to undergo surgery, “which really sucks,” but he’s confident it’s a “pretty minor procedure” which will not keep him out of the ring for a long time.

The former MLW champion joined TNA earlier this year and has also appeared on NXT as part of the talent exchange the two had going on for months.
